Inadequate Flashing Installation
Picking the appropriate products isn't the only element that can cause roof covering problems; inadequate flashing installation can likewise produce substantial issues. Flashing is critical for guiding water far from vulnerable areas, such as chimneys, skylights, and roof covering valleys. If it's not installed effectively, you take the chance of water invasion, which can lead to mold and mildew growth and architectural damages.
When you set up blinking, guarantee it's the best type for your roof covering's style and the local environment. For example, metal flashing is typically extra durable than plastic in locations with hefty rainfall or snow. Make certain the flashing overlaps properly and is secured snugly to prevent spaces where water can permeate via.

Neglecting Air Flow Demands
While lots of property owners concentrate on the visual and structural facets of roofing system setup, overlooking air flow demands can cause major lasting consequences. Proper ventilation is crucial for managing temperature level and moisture levels in your attic, avoiding problems like mold and mildew development, wood rot, and ice dams. If you do not install appropriate air flow, you're establishing your roofing system up for failure.
To avoid this error, first, evaluate your home's specific air flow requirements. A balanced system commonly includes both consumption and exhaust vents to advertise air movement. Guarantee you've installed soffit vents along the eaves and ridge vents at the optimal of your roof covering. This combination allows hot air to leave while cooler air gets in, maintaining your attic space comfy.
Likewise, take into consideration the sort of roof covering material you've picked. Some products may require added air flow strategies. Confirm your local building codes for ventilation standards, as they can differ considerably.
Finally, do not forget to check your air flow system on a regular basis. Clogs from particles or insulation can hinder airflow, so maintain those vents clear.
